Plans approved for £75m Wembley Parade

5 Jan 17 Construction of a new neighbourhood of 195 flats is set to transform a vacant industrial site in Wembley known as Amex House.

The £75m development, known as Wembley Parade, will be delivered by London residential developer Anthology following planning approval from Brent Council on 14th December 2016.

Anthology bought the 1.6 acre brownfield site on North End Road from civil engineering contractor Durkin in 2014 with backing from Oaktree Capital Management.

Anthology development director Neil Sams said: “Wembley Parade has been designed with great attention to detail – the unique development is sleek, in-keeping with the new surrounding buildings and curves to reflect the Wealdstone Brook which runs behind the site.”

Wembley Parade development, designed by GRID Architects, will provide a mix of social rented, shared ownership and private homes.
